What It Is:
This is a phonics worksheet focusing on consonant blends. It presents a list of consonant blends (gl, cl, tr, nd, sn, sc) at the top. Below, there are incomplete words with blanks at the beginning (e.g., ee, owman, wi). The student needs to fill in the blanks with the correct consonant blend from the list. To the right of the words are corresponding pictures (cloud, snowman, scarf, tree, gloves, wind). The student must then draw a line from the completed word to the correct picture.
Grade Level Suitability:
This worksheet is suitable for Kindergarten and 1st grade. It reinforces early phonics skills like recognizing and using consonant blends, making it appropriate for students learning to read and spell.
Why Use It:
This worksheet helps students practice identifying and applying consonant blends to form words. It also reinforces vocabulary and matching skills through the picture-word association activity. It enhances phonemic awareness and reading comprehension.
How to Use It:
First, review the consonant blends at the top of the page. Then, for each incomplete word, choose the correct consonant blend from the list to complete the word. After writing in the blend, read the completed word aloud. Finally, draw a line connecting the word to the matching picture.
Target Users:
This worksheet is designed for kindergarten and first-grade students who are learning to read and spell, particularly those working on phonics and consonant blends. It is also useful for students who need extra practice with vocabulary and word-picture association.
